Highlights
Are people in Mill Valley older or younger than people in Chicago?
- The Median Age in Mill Valley is 12.8 years older than in Chicago.

Are housing costs cheaper in Mill Valley or Chicago?
- Mill Valley housing costs are 538.6% more expensive than Chicago housing costs.

Which city has a longer commute, Mill Valley or Chicago?
- The average commute for residents of Mill Valley is 3.8 minutes shorter than it is for residents of Chicago.

 Chicago, ILMill Valley, CAUnited States
 Population2,742,11914,240329,725,481
 Median Income$65,781$179,529$69,021
 Median Age35.147.938.4
 Avg. Home Price$284,100$1,814,300$338,100
 Unemployment Rate9.0%4.8%6.0%
 Avg. Commute Time34.6330.8726.38
